UNRWA Spanish Committee to hold World Refugee Day Gaza Solidarity Concert in Madrid
The Spanish Committee for the UN Relief and Works Agency for Palestine Refugees (UNRWAce) will hold a benefit concert in solidarity with the Palestine refugee children of the Gaza Strip on 20 June – World Refugee Day.
All proceeds from the concert will support the UN Agency’s work in Gaza, as the Israeli blockade of the coastal strip enters its sixth year.
Joining forces on stage at the 800-person capacity Sala Arena in Madrid will be renowned singer-songwriters Ismael Serrano, Pedro Guerra, Carlos Chaouen, Marwan, Luis Ramiro, Andrés Suárez, Lucas, and Sheila Blanco. All artists will perform for free.
Ticket-holders will be treated to performances including last year’s 'Luces Errantes' (Stray Lights), a joint project by Ismael Serrano and UNRWAce featuring students from the prestigious Edward Said National Conservatory in Ramallah. The benefits of that song have contributed towards improving the situation of thousands of children in Gaza.
Today, Palestinian refugees represent one-third of the world's refugees: among them, the child population is the most vulnerable.
